Our goal is to present departmental knowledge of impeachment and to address questions the audience may have on the meaning, process, and validity of impeachment. The session is divided into the following sections: Presentations on a) the process, b) historical examples, c) the definition of “high crimes and misdemeanors”, and d) contemporary issues related to the Article of Impeachment and its role in the empowerment of Congress. Following brief presentations on each of these categories, we will open the floor for a Q&A session.
